Title: Juan Huguet Clotet: Innovator in Pharmaceutical Processes
Introduction
Juan Huguet Clotet is a notable inventor based in Sant Joan Despi, Spain. He has made significant contributions to the field of pharmaceuticals, holding a total of five patents. His work focuses on improving processes for the manufacture of complex chemical compounds, particularly those used in medicinal applications.
Latest Patents
Among his latest patents is a process for the manufacture of R-6-hydroxy-8-[1-hydroxy-2-[2-(4-methoxyphenyl)-1,1-dimethylethylaminoethyl]-2H-1,4-benzoxazin-3(4H)-one hydrochloride. This invention provides an improved method for producing this compound in high purity and yield. Another significant patent involves an improved method for preparing a rufinamide intermediate, which is essential for the production of a new polymorphic form of Rufinamide, designated as Form R-5. This new polymorph exhibits good stability and is suitable for pharmaceutical use, particularly in treating convulsions and epilepsy.
Career Highlights
Juan has worked with several companies throughout his career, including Inke, S.A. and Laboratories Lesvi, S.L. His experience in these organizations has contributed to his expertise in pharmaceutical processes and innovations.
Collaborations
He has collaborated with notable coworkers such as Pere Dalmases Barjoan and Jordi Peirats Masia. Their joint efforts have likely enhanced the development and refinement of his patented processes.
